Q

Mechanism of myosin movement:

A

Binds ATP, head is released from actin
Hydrolysis of ATP, myosin head rotates into cocked state
Myosin head binds the actin filament
Power stroke - release of Pi and elastic energy straightens the myosin, moves actin filament left

Q

Differences between myosin and kinesin mechanism?

A

Kinesin bound to MT WITH ATP and is released when ATP is hydrolysed to ADP and Pi
Myosin bound to actin without ATP and is released when ATP binds
